Haryana Agriculture Minister launches Mukhya Mantri Bagwani Bima Yojana portal

31-Mar-2022
Chandigarh Mar 31 PTI Haryana Agriculture Minister J P Dalal on Thursday launched the portal of Mukhya Mantri Bagwani Bima Yojana Under this scheme farmers will be compensated for the damage caused to their crops due to adverse weather and natural calamities he said He said that adverse weather and natural calamities like hailstorm adverse temperature frost flood cloudburst breakage of canaldrain water logging high wind velocity and fire which cause crop loss were included in this scheme Dalal said that 21 crops are covered under this scheme-- 14 vegetables tomato onion potato cauliflower peas carrot okra bottle gourd bitter gourd brinjal green chilli capsicum cabbage radish 2 spices turmeric garlic and five fruits mango kinnow berry guava lychee The minister said the Haryana Government will promote organic farming in a big way to enhance the income of farmers For promoting this it has been decided to create a separate wing in the Agriculture Department This wing will pay special attention to the quality and increase the productivity of food grains in the state Besides this for farmers a training programme would be chalked out and separate clusters will also be formed he said after launching the portal of Mukhya Mantri Bagwani Bima Yojana The minister also said that farmers of the state would also be encouraged for diversification of crops According to an official statement Dalal said that the Yojana will be optional for all those farmers who will get registered under Meri Fasal Mera Byora Under the scheme the sum assured will be Rs 30000 per acre for vegetables and spices and Rs 40000 per acre for fruits The farmers contributionshare will be only 25 per cent of the assured amount which is Rs 750 per acre in vegetables and Rs 1000 per acre in fruits he said The Agriculture Minister said that the compensation has been divided into four categories 25 per cent 50 per cent 75 per cent and 100 per cent Dalal informed that Rs 10 crore will be kept by the government as initial capital for the scheme Compensation amount will be based on survey Monitoring of the scheme review and resolution of disputes will be done through the state-level and district-level committees constituted under the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ana he said He said that the State Government is committed to implement farmer friendly schemes and policies PTI SUN MR MR

Man jailed for 5 years for smuggling fake currency notes

01-Mar-2022
Kolkata Feb 28 PTI A special NIA court here sentenced a man on Monday to five years in jail for smuggling fake Indian currency notes an official said The court also imposed a fine of Rs 40000 on Ketabul S K of West Bengals Malda district after convicting him of the relevant offences under the Indian Penal Code the official of the premier investigation agency said The case was originally registered in West Bengals Murshidabad district in July 2018 following the seizure of the FICN having a face value of Rs 192000 the official said The NIA had re-registered the case in August 2018 and filed charge-sheets against three accused in October 2018 and December 2018 the official said Two accused were already convicted earlier in December 2021 the official added PTI CPS SKL RAX RAX

NHAI toll revenue to jump to Rs 140 lakh cr in 3 yrs Gadkari

21-Dec-2021
New Delhi Dec 21 PTI Toll revenue of the NHAI will soar to Rs 140 lakh crore per annum in the next three years from Rs 40000 crore per annum currently Union minister Nitin Gadkari said on Tuesday Addressing an event here the Road Transport and Highways Minister said that there is a huge opportunity for investors in Indias infrastructure sector as the traffic density is rising every year Our state-owned NHAIs current toll income is Rs 40000 crore It will rise to Rs 140 lakh crore in the next three years he said Inviting investments in the infrastructure sector Gadkari said that size of Indian economy is rising so naturally internal rate of return on infrastructure projects is also rising The Union minister said conciliation committees should decide cases related to road infrastructure projects within three months as delay in the decision making process results in higher costs For faster settlement of claims through conciliation and reduce liabilities the National Highways Authority of India NHAI has rigorously started the process of conciliation by constituting three Conciliation Committees of Independent Experts CCIE of three members each These committees are being headed by retired officials from the judiciary senior experts from public administration finance and the private sector Making a strong case for accelerating the bankruptcy resolution process Gadkari said no purpose is served if the financial matter is held up at courts and tribunals for a longer time We need to change our thinking about the issues concerning bankruptcy of companies as there are business cycles and all defaults are not frauds Gadkari who is known for his frank views on any issue said Referring to the delay in getting completion of bankruptcy related cases the road transport and highways minister said the bankruptcy tribunal NCLT is facing shortage of judges When a patient is serious he needs to be treated immediately There is no point in giving oxygen to a patient after he is dead Similarly in case of financial disputes the matter has to be resolved fast and not delayed as is happening at NCLT he said Gadkari said he would like to set up a committee under a retired judge to find out why the state-owned NHAI lost arbitration appeal cases in the Supreme Court SC in the last five years The minister said he would penalise those who are responsible for mindlessly filing appeals in the Supreme Court in arbitration awards which have gone against PTI BKS CS MR MR

Chaos erupts in Delhi courtroom during sentencing in lawyer assault case

30-Nov-2021
New Delhi Nov 30 PTI Chaos erupted in a courtroom in Delhis Tis Hazari court on Tuesday with lawyers chanting slogans and standing atop tables and chairs as they awaited the pronouncement of order on sentencing in an assault case in which Delhi High Court Bar Associations DHCBA ex-President Rajiv Khosla is a convictKhosla was convicted last month in an assault case for criminal intimidation and voluntarily causing hurt to complainant Sujata Kohli who was a lawyer at Tis Hazari court at that time She went on to become a judge in the Delhi judiciary and retired as a District and Sessions Judge last yearCourtroom number 38 where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Gajender Singh Nagar presided saw lawyers chanting shame shame shame and saying that the judge was working under pressure and favouring Kohli Pass the order We want to hear it yelled out one lawyer Police personnel also stood outside the courtroom for securityFew lawyers also climbed on the top of the tables and chairs in the jam-packed courtroom to hear the arguments between the counsels of both the convict and victim During the proceedings Kohli asked the judge Why is he Khosla being allowed to enter the court with a crowd He is here with hundreds of lawyers The convict is again and again reflecting that he has no regard for rule of law He loves to abuse the courtThe former judge who appeared through the video conference said that Khosla used unparliamentary language against the court and the judges post-judgement of his conviction Advocate Birender Sangwa representing Khosla however rebutted This court was favouring the complainant in all manner She took undue advantage of her position after becoming the judge Sangwa claimed that his client Khosla neither used unparliamentary language in the court nor threatened her or tampered with the witnesses Khosla has earned the goodwill he told the courtAfter the argument and chanting of more slogans the judge directed Khosla to pay a total compensation of Rs 40000 to the state and the victim He said that in default of these payments Khosla will undergo simple imprisonment of 30 days The judge further said that even though the convict assaulted a lady bar member in the presence of a number of lawyers he does not deem it fit to send him to imprisonment as he is not convicted in any other case and is a senior citizen After the pronouncement of the order lawyers chanted slogans of Vakeel Ekta Zindabad and Rajiv Khosla Zindabad and applaudedKhosla was convicted on October 29 in the assault case for offences punishable under Sections 323 voluntarily causing hurt and 506 criminal intimidation of the India Penal Code IPC The maximum punishment under these Sections entails a jail term of up to two yearsThe allegations against Khosla were that in July 1994 when he was the Secretary of Delhi Bar Association DBA he asked Kohli to join a seminar and on her refusal threatened her that all facilities from the Bar Association would be withdrawn and she would be dispossessed of her seat as wellKohli had filed a civil suit on August 1 1994 seeking injunction but despite that her table and chair were removed from their spotJust before the civil judge hearing her suit could inspect the spot Khosla along with a mob of 40-50 lawyers allegedly surrounded her she allegedAccording to her complaint Khosla pulled her hair dragged her twisted her arms uttered filthy abuses and threatened herWhile the incident took place in August 1994 the case came before the court in July 1995PTI AAK RKS RKS

Centre releases full Rs 159 lakh cr to states this fiscal as back-to-back loan to compensate for GST shortfall

28-Oct-2021
New Delhi Oct 28 PTI The Centre on Thursday released the balance Rs 44000 crore to states as loan to compensate for the GST shortfall taking the total such amount to Rs 159 lakh crore this fiscal This release of funds as back-to-back loans is in addition to the bi-monthly GST compensation being given out of cess collection The 43rd GST Council meeting on May 28 2021 had decided that the Centre would borrow Rs 159 lakh crore in 2021-22 and release it to states and UTs with legislature on a back-to-back basis to meet the resource gap due to the shortfall in compensation on account of inadequate amount collected in the GST compensation fund This amount is as per the principles adopted for a similar facility in the last fiscal 2020-21 where Rs 110 lakh crore was released to states The Ministry of Finance has released Rs 44000 crore today to the States and UTs with Legislature under the back-to-back loan facility in lieu of GST Compensation the ministry said in a statement The ministry had on July 15 and October 7 released Rs 75000 crore and Rs 40000 crore respectively to the states With the release of Rs 44000 crore on Thursday the total amount released in the current financial year as back-to-back loan in-lieu of GST compensation is Rs 159 lakh crore the statement added This amount of Rs 159 lakh crore is over and above the compensation in excess of Rs 1 lakh crore based on cess collection that is estimated to be released to statesunion territories with legislature during this financial year The sum total of Rs 259 lakh crore is expected to exceed the amount of GST compensation accruing in FY 2021-22 the ministry added The Rs 44000 crore being released now is funded from the Government of India securities issued in the current financial year at a Weighted Average Yield of 569 per cent No additional market borrowing by the central government is envisaged on account of this release It is expected that this release will help the StatesUTs in planning their public expenditure among other things for improving health infrastructure and taking up infrastructure projects it said PTI JD ABM ABM

Haryana cabinet accords approval for implementing Mukhyamantri Bagwani Bima Yojana

22-Sep-2021
Chandigarh Sep 22 PTI The Haryana government has decided to cover farmers growing horticultural crops under Mukhyamantri Bagwani Bima scheme A decision to this regard was taken in a meeting of the state cabinet held here on Wednesday evening under the chairmanship of Chief Minister M L Khattar The Cabinet has accorded its approval for the implementation of Mukhyamantri Bagwani Bima Yojana MBBY - an assurance-based scheme to compensate crop losses due to adverse weather and natural calamities for farmers growing horticulture crops an official statement said Horticulture growers face huge financial losses due to various factors biotic factors that include losses due to sudden outbreak of crop diseases insect-pests infestation and abiotic factors like untimely rainfall hailstorms drought frost extreme temperatures it said The Department of Horticulture has examined various crop insurance schemes covering horticultural crops and felt the need that a new scheme is required to cover crop loss due to natural calamities and adverse weather conditions This scheme has been designed as Horticulture Crop Assurance Scheme and named as MBBY with the aim to encourage farmers to cultivate high-risk horticulture crops The parameters like hailstorms frost rainfall flood fire etc which lead to crop loss have been taken under the scheme A total of 21 vegetable fruit and spice crops will be covered under the scheme Under this scheme farmers need to pay nominal Rs 750 for vegetable and spice crop and Rs 1000 for fruit crops against a sum assured of Rs 30000 and Rs 40000 respectively The claim compensation will be based on survey and extent of loss in four categories of 25 per cent 50 per cent 75 per cent and 100 per cent The scheme will be optional and will cover the entire state Farmers will have to opt for this scheme while registering their crop and area on Meri Fasal Mera Byora MFMB portal Season wise crop registration period will be fixed and notified from time to time The scheme will be implemented at Individual Field that is crop loss assessment will be done at the individual field level the statement said A seed capital of Rs 10 crore will be kept by the State Government State and District Level Committees under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ana PMFBY will monitor review and resolve the disputes at State Level as well as District Level PTI SUN VSD MR MR
